Event overview

The Santa Barbara Nine Trails endurance event on March 14, 2026 is a trail running event based at the Jesusita Trailhead on San Roque Road in Santa Barbara, CA. The event offers the following courses:

  • 35 mile endurance run
  • Half course out-and-back between Jesusita Trailhead and the Gibraltar Road aid station

The full course covers most of the Santa Barbara front country trail system, running from Jesusita Trailhead to Romero Canyon Trailhead and back.

Course and logistics

The 35 mile course includes more than ten thousand vertical feet of ascent and descent on steep, rocky and technical trails. Named sections include Inspiration Point, Tunnel Trail, Rattlesnake Trail, Gibraltar Road, West Cold Spring Trail, Cold Spring Trail, Edison Catwalk, Buena Vista Trail and Romero Canyon. The course will be minimally marked with colored ribbon and participants are required to use GPX digital mapping; a GPX file will be provided prior to the event.

Aid stations are located at approximately miles 9, 17, 26, 31 and the finish. There will be long unsupported sections between stations. The event is intended for experienced distance runners and is not crew or spectator friendly. There is no parking at the start/finish area; drop off and pick up are required.
